Transaction 56495c75efd94734cf77cc705ebeb504af8c282b2cd4d02ae98144cd431601ad

2 Input
2 Outputs
  • 56495c75efd94734cf77cc705ebeb504af8c282b2cd4d02ae98144cd431601ad:0
  • value  5235880
    address  1FMvGSpqbZA5uSr3DXya3brJw1PJbtrVvy
  • 56495c75efd94734cf77cc705ebeb504af8c282b2cd4d02ae98144cd431601ad:1
  • value  1457964
    address  bc1q9ynjtrvgt3dcav2jqxmm7u38v3wmhhkylldh6t